Specific function: Catalyzes amidations at positions B, D, E, and G on adenosylcobyrinic A,C-diamide. NH(2) groups are provided by glutamine, and one molecule of ATP is hydrogenolyzed for each amidation [H]

COG id: COG3442

COG function: function code R; Predicted glutamine amidotransferase
